Hello and thank you for visiting our website. The Penn State University Actuarial Science Club strives to help actuarial students pass actuarial exams and find employment.
Prospective Students: Actuarial Science can be found under the Risk Management major in the Smeal College of Business, the Actuarial Mathematics option in the Mathematics Department or the Actuarial Statistics option in the Statistics Department. Students in all three Actuarial Options take the same Actuarial courses.
We are the largest Actuarial program in the US, based on the number of students passing actuarial exams, and we are a Center of Actuarial Excellence, one of 21 in the world.
